Transaction 76785336c8f3baf41dbcd6c2f894fbb8fdd326d8b4b0c014e6500cd2114a567d

6 Input
2 Outputs
  • 76785336c8f3baf41dbcd6c2f894fbb8fdd326d8b4b0c014e6500cd2114a567d:0
  • value  13379721
    address  1DJG4PtKf22TF3og2qLrqHQLS6YBUX62K
  • 76785336c8f3baf41dbcd6c2f894fbb8fdd326d8b4b0c014e6500cd2114a567d:1
  • value  3753074
    address  3MXETuNRQzDw88FhEq9PFMf1nyfpRfazKo